testosterone

Testosterone gel is a medicated product designed for hormone replacement therapy in adult men with low testosterone levels, a condition known as hypogonadism. This gel is applied to the skin once daily, where it is absorbed into the bloodstream to help achieve normal testosterone levels. Testosterone is crucial for developing and maintaining male characteristics such as a deep voice, body hair, muscle mass, and bone density. It also plays an essential role in maintaining sexual function and desire. While this treatment is convenient, it poses a risk of transferring the medication to others through direct skin contact. This medication is not intended for use by women. Always consult healthcare professionals to ensure safe and effective use.

Testim Warnings

It is crucial to be aware of the safety information and warnings related to testosterone gel to ensure its safe use. Below are key considerations and precautions:

  • Risk of Transfer through Skin Contact: Children and females should avoid direct skin contact with unwashed or uncovered areas where testosterone gel has been applied. This can prevent unintended absorption, which may lead to early puberty in children and the development of male characteristics in females. If unexpected signs of puberty or male features appear, contact a healthcare provider immediately.

  • Increased Red Blood Cell Count and Blood Clots: Testosterone gel can elevate red blood cell counts, potentially causing blood clots. Regular blood tests may be recommended to monitor these levels.

  • Heart-Related Risks: There is a risk of heart attack, stroke, or cardiac death associated with testosterone gel. Seek emergency medical help if you experience symptoms such as chest pain, cold sweats, left arm pain, difficulty breathing, impaired speech, or weakness on one side.

  • Potential for Misuse and Dependency: Testosterone gel is a controlled substance due to risks of misuse, dependency, and addiction. Misuse can lead to severe heart and mental health issues. Ensure it is used strictly as prescribed, without combining with other testosterone products.

  • Prostate Health Concerns: Those with an enlarged prostate may experience worsening symptoms. Notify your healthcare provider if you notice changes in your urinary habits.

  • Liver Health: While testosterone gel is not known to cause liver issues, be vigilant for symptoms such as stomach pain, light-colored stools, dark urine, or jaundice, and report these to your healthcare provider.

  • Swelling and Edema: The gel may cause fluid retention, leading to swelling in the arms and legs. This is particularly concerning for individuals with heart, liver, or kidney conditions or those taking corticosteroids.

  • Sleep Apnea: Testosterone gel can exacerbate sleep breathing problems, especially in individuals with obesity or lung disease. Increased daytime sleepiness or observed breathing interruptions during sleep should be discussed with a healthcare provider.

  • High Calcium Levels: Those with cancer using testosterone gel may experience elevated calcium levels in the blood. Regular monitoring through blood tests may be necessary to manage this risk.

Contraindications: Do not use testosterone gel if you have breast or prostate cancer or if you are pregnant or breastfeeding, as it poses significant health risks in these cases.

For any concerns or symptoms experienced while using this medication, consult your healthcare provider promptly.

Testim Side Effects

When using this medication, you may encounter some common side effects, generally mild in nature. These include nausea, vomiting, headaches, dizziness, hair loss, trouble sleeping, and skin issues like redness, swelling, or acne. Additionally, changes in sexual desire, mood swings, and appetite fluctuations may occur. While these effects are usually not serious, if they persist or worsen, consult your healthcare provider.

It's important to monitor your blood pressure, as this medication may cause an increase. If you have diabetes, be aware that it might lower your blood sugar levels, so watch for symptoms such as shakiness or sweating. For any signs of low blood sugar, discuss with your doctor as adjustments in diabetes medication might be necessary.

Serious side effects, although rare, require immediate medical attention. These include chest pain, sudden dizziness, shortness of breath, or signs of a stroke such as face drooping or difficulty speaking. Other severe reactions might involve liver damage indicators like yellowing of the skin, severe abdominal pain, or dark urine. Painful, prolonged erections and severe allergic reactions are also critical and need prompt medical help.

If you experience any severe side effects or other unexpected symptoms, seek urgent medical assistance. This list does not cover all possible side effects, so keep in touch with your healthcare provider for any concerns.

Testim Interactions

Certain medications can interact with testosterone gel, so it's important to inform your doctor and pharmacist about all the medications and supplements you are taking, including prescription, over-the-counter, vitamins, and herbal products. Specifically, testosterone gel may interact with blood thinners like Warfarin, Anisindione, Dicumarol, and Phenprocoumon. This interaction may require dose adjustments or careful monitoring by your healthcare provider. Additionally, testosterone gel can affect the results of some lab tests, such as thyroid function and creatinine levels, potentially leading to incorrect outcomes. Therefore, ensure that lab personnel and all your healthcare providers are aware that you are using this medication.
